A Comprehensive Reliability Assessment Tool for Electronic Systems

The Reliability Analysis Center (RAC) has developed a new methodology and associated engineering software tool, PRISMŽ, to assess the reliability of electronic systems. The methodology includes new component-level reliability prediction models (RACRates) as well as a process for assessing the reliability of systems due to non-component variables which are major contributors to electronic system reliability.
